The Seven Deadly Sins: Golgius
A minor character of nnt/tsds and one who had a face revel with a bit of monologuing and yet with no clear indication that he will return
It seemed so unnecessary and pointless almost as if it was a mere excuse to present him maskless.
Chapter 179: Pursuit of Hope (online source)
Chapter 180: Wandering Knight (online source) (reference to Zaratras)
It shows that he was running away from villagers who decided to turn him in to assure their own safely. He finds himself in a dense fog (The Forest of White Dreams) and runs into what he assumed was a demon but was really Hawk Mama.
And of course Elizabeth saved him unable to ignore anyone in need regardless of whom it may be
But it is this that throws me off the most...
Understandably he has made poor choices or those that have resulted others demise.
But he is well aware of it and does not deny that he walks a path of darkness. He has also acknowledged Elizabeth's kindness but the way he says it almost seems odd.
Instead of saying something like her being too cheery and naïve or just simply too nice. It makes sense say radiate too much light after he had said spent most of his life in the darkness but it's the 'radiate' that interests me. This is an online translation so the printed English version is likely to be different but still it’s an odd choice of words I think.
Also he says most of his life; that makes me even more curious like I wanna think he’s a demon but frankly that doesn’t make much sense especially given the fact that they terrify him and that he’s pretty damn sure he’s gonna die sooner or later.
Am I being over analytical? Yeah but this has been stuck in my head for probably months now. I had been waiting for some hints in the newest chapters that may indicate some comeback.
I think he has potential it’s just why bother reintroducing him; not that I mind I really like his character.
I really love to seem some sort of teamwork between him and Meliodas or even Elizabeth *Spolier?* after her reawakening as a Goddess, her former self.
